BERGAMO, Italy (AP) — Cole Palmer, who has only just returned from injury, will be rested for Chelsea’s Champions League trip to Atalanta on Tuesday.

The England forward made his first start since September for his club in Saturday’s goalless Premier League draw at Bournemouth.

“Cole is in part of his process in this moment,” Chelsea manager Enzo Maresca said at his pre-match press conference Monday. “He’s not available, he can’t play two games in a row in three days. We planned that and it’s just a way to protect him.”

Palmer was initially sidelined by a groin problem before his return was put back by a toe injury.
